SQL Server 2008中FILESTREAM访问被拒绝(SQL Server 2008 fi

2019-09-24 08:18发布

有人可以与帮助Access is denied试图将FILESTREAM数据插入到SQL Server 2008时收到错误消息?

我有一个应用程序特定的用户配置的应用程序池内运行ASP.NET应用程序。 web.config中使用集成安全性...

<connectionStrings>
   <add name="MyApp" 
        connectionString="Data Source=localhost;Initial Catalog=MyDatabase;Integrated Security=SSPI;"
        providerName="System.Data.SqlClient" />
</connectionStrings>

该应用程序的Windows用户所属的数据库角色, web_app 。 此角色具有执行和选择权限。 不过,我收到下面的异常?

System.ComponentModel.Win32Exception (0x80004005): Access is denied

在此先感谢所有帮助。

Answer 1:

  1. 检查SQL Server服务帐户必须FILESTREAM文件夹的访问权。
  2. 检查FILESTREAM文件夹是不是只读。


文章来源: SQL Server 2008 filestream access is denied